Как рассчитать точность многоклассового классификатора с помощью нейронной сети - PullRequest
1 голос
/ 25 февраля 2020

Когда выходные данные (прогноз) являются вероятностями, приходящимися на функцию Softmax, и целью обучения является однократный тип, как мы можем сравнивать эти два различных типа данных для вычисления точности?

(количество тренировочных данных, классифицированных правильно) / (количество общих тренировочных данных) * 100%

Ответы [ 2 ]

0 голосов
/ 25 февраля 2020

preds - список вероятностей метки

 index=np.argmax(preds)

он вернет индекс той метки, к какому классу он принадлежит

0 голосов
/ 25 февраля 2020

Обычно мы назначаем метку класса с наибольшей вероятностью на выходе функции soft max в качестве метки.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...